Digital to Analog Converters (DAC) Analog Devices, Inc. LTC2657BIUFD-L16#TRPBF Overview

The Digital to Analog Converters (DAC) Analog Devices, Inc. LTC2657BIUFD-L16#TRPBF is a high-precision, 16-bit voltage-output digital-to-analog converter (DAC) that delivers exceptional performance and accuracy. Housed in a compact 20-QFN package, this DAC is designed for sophisticated analog circuit applications where space and precision are critical. Its advanced design features ensure low noise output and high drive capability, making it ideal for demanding applications in both commercial and industrial settings.
